Avalon Posted August 23, 2012 Report Posted August 23, 2012 I've got the chance to to acquire a Muzzlelite Bullpup stock for my 10/22. Can anyone tell me if they haveany experiecne of Bullpup stocks? How do you fit a scope to it?
Microgunner Posted August 23, 2012 Report Posted August 23, 2012 I have and still own only one bullpup rifle, a FN FS2000 in 5.56mm.The only advantage I can see to the bullpup is OAL.Everything else is a deficit.Balance is off.Trigger is poor.Ejection can be a problem with most bullpups.So, if OAL is not really, really important to you then I'd say you're degrading your rifle's performance by going bullpup.
